Optimal Resource Allocation for Reliability of Modular Software Systems

Journal Title: Computer Science and Mathematical Modelling - Year 2011, Vol 0, Issue 7

Abstract

Considerable development resources are consumed during the software-testing phase. The software development manager has to decide how to use the testing-resources effectively in order to maximize the software quality and reliability. The paper discusses a management problem to achieve a reliable software system efficiently during the module testing stage by applying a software reliability growth model. This model both describes the software-error detection phenomenon and represents the relationship between the cumulative number of errors encountered by software testing and the time span of the testing. As testing cost and software reliability are both important factors in the testing-resource allocation problems an investigation is performed in the paper to search for the optimal solution for modular software system with the objectives of maximising system reliability and minimising testing cost.
